Date: 30th November 2024
Location: Horamavu, Bangalore
Hosted by: Asha Kiran Special Needs School in collaboration with 18NotOut
A Celebration of Creativity, Confidence, and Inclusion
The Hope Fest, held at Asha Kiran Special Needs School, was a vibrant celebration of talent, creativity, and inclusion. Organized in collaboration with 18NotOut, the event showcased the incredible abilities of children from various schools, breaking stereotypes and fostering self-expression.
The day featured heartfelt performances, colorful stalls with handcrafted products, and delicious food that brought everyone together in a joyful atmosphere.
